Full Description
Advanced Blazor Architecture with .NET 10 and Azure OpenAI: Enterprise-Grade Design Patterns, AI Integration, and Cloud-Ready Solutions will guide developers, architects, and technology leaders through building scalable, intelligent, and cloud-ready applications with Blazor. The book explores the latest .NET 10 enhancements such as Minimal APIs, AOT compilation, and WebAssembly performance, while showcasing enterprise-grade architecture patterns like Clean Code Architecture, Domain-Driven Design, and micro-frontends. A unique focus will be given to integrating Azure OpenAI - embedding intelligent assistants, content generation, and sentiment analysis securely within Blazor apps. The book also demonstrates cloud-ready deployment with Azure App Services, Kubernetes, and CI/CD pipelines, alongside performance and security strategies such as zero-trust security and AI compliance. This combination of deep technical coverage and practical patterns makes the book both timely and essential for enterprise professionals preparing for the future of cloud and AI-driven development.
What You Will Learn
.NET 10 Enhancements: Minimal APIs, AOT compilation, WebAssembly performance improvements.
Enterprise Architecture Patterns: Clean Architecture, Domain-Driven Design, micro-frontends, and modular UI components.
AI Integration with Azure OpenAI: Embedding intelligent assistants, content generation, sentiment analysis, and secure prompt handling into Blazor apps.
Cloud-Ready Deployment: Azure App Services, Kubernetes, containerized workflows, and CI/CD pipelines.
Performance & Security: Optimizing state management, implementing zero-trust security, and ensuring AI-driven features meet compliance standards.
Contents
Chapter 1: Introduction to Modern Blazor. -Chapter 2: .NET 10 Enhancements for Blazor.- Chapter 3: Enterprise-Grade Blazor Architecture.- Chapter 4: Micro-Frontends and Modular UI.- Chapter 5: Event-Driven and Reactive Patterns.- Chapter 6: Introducing Azure OpenAI in Blazor.- Chapter 7: Practical AI Features in Blazor.- Chapter 8: Secure AI Prompt Handling.- Chapter 9: Deploying Blazor at Scale.- Chapter 10: CI/CD for Blazor and AI Apps.- Chapter 11: Cloud-Native Observability and Resilience.- Chapter 12: Optimizing Performance in Blazor Apps.- Chapter 13: Zero-Trust and Enterprise Security.- Chapter 14: End-to-End Case Study: AI-Enhanced Enterprise App.- Chapter 15: Future of Blazor and AI in Enterprise Solutions.



